Taxonomy Phenylpropanoids and polyketides > Isoflavonoids > Furanoisoflavonoids > Pterocarpans
IUPAC Name (2R,10R)-21-methoxy-17,17-dimethyl-3,12,16-trioxapentacyclo[11.8.0.02,10.04,9.015,20]henicosa-1(13),4(9),5,7,14,18,20-heptaen-6-ol

Molecular Formula C21H20O5
Molecular Weight 352.40 g/mol
Exact Mass 352.13107373 g/mol
Topological Polar Surface Area (TPSA) 57.20 Ų
XlogP 3.50
